Concrete Institute of Australia

20 Jun, 2016

The Concrete Institute of Australia is an independent not-for-profit association founded in 1969, which provides professional development opportunities for stakeholders in the concrete and construction industry. Its vision – to strive for excellence in concrete!

The mission of the Institute is to provide resources and opportunities for promotion and development of excellence in concrete research, technology, application, design and construction The Members share a common interest in the pursuit of excellence in these areas. Members of the Institute can be individuals (including special categories for under 30’s and students) companies and organisations, and academic institutions.

The Concrete Institute of Australia has a significant role to play in Australian concrete construction by ensuring that up to date and relevant knowledge is available to all sectors of the concrete industry to support the profession and allow educated decisions to be made. By being “in the mix” with the Institute and the concrete industry, professional development can be found in many different forms, and allows individuals and organisations to pursue these without having a dramatic impact on time, money, and resource.
